Extract frames from mp4 matlab tutorial pdf

Extracting frames from webcam matlab answers matlab. For information on displaying the frames in the structure s as a movie, see the movie function reference page. Follow 10 views last 30 days nabeel ahmed on 16 mar 2018. If you were to look through the various documentation in current matlab versions, you would find that videoreader does have a numberofframes property that can be accessed after you have used videoreader but before you have read any frames, but it turns out that the number it provides is an estimate assuming fixed framerate. Microsoft word tutorial how to insert images into word document table duration. Extracting frames from a video file in matlab yang zhao. Convert image to movie frame matlab im2frame mathworks. How to extract frames of a video matlab answers matlab.

Extracting frames from a video file in matlab youtube. Construct a videoreader object associated with the sample file xylophone. For example you can extract every hundredth video frame, frames in every 10 seconds, total 50 frames or even every frame. Converting a video individual frames and back to video in. Is it possible to extract the text from pdf file using matlab script. For example, specify the second argument of read as 18 27. Follow 18 views last 30 days naseer khan on 21 aug.

Matlab code to convert video to sequence of frames pantech blog. To extract all the contents of a zip file, doubleclick the zip file in the current folder browser. So, i need to extract the i frames and then encrypt them. I am using the following code to read and extract entire frames of a video, but problem is the frames are stored in multi as shown in the attached image. Read frames from a video starting at a specific time or frame index, read frames within a specified interval. Read yuv videos and extract the frames in matlab youtube. Then rebuilds a new movie by recalling the saved images from disk. Cascade after reading the video one can get the frames of the video. Follow 11 views last 30 days alpa patel on 30 may 20. Currently i have used multimedia file block for reading the video and what block should i use for extracting frames one by one.

Learn more about video processing, from multimedia file block simulink. This file was selected as matlab central pick of the week demo to extract frames and get frame means from a movie and optionally save individual frames to separate image files. Extract frames from a mp4 video and saving in a file. For my work, the input video is a scene of people moving through streetsmalls. Then, convert the image files to an avi file using videowriter. How to extract frames of a video matlab answers matlab central. You can find an example on how to use the code in example. There are four extraction methods to choose from, extract an image every number of frames, extract an image every number of seconds, take a total number of frames from the video or extract every single frame. Append data from each video frame to the structure array. Extracting frames from webcam follow 38 views last 30 days khaled alfaleh on 26 mar 2017. The size and format of video depends on the videoformat property of v. Name is a property name and value is the corresponding value. This code could be used for video processing applications in matlab. The total size of the extracted images may be several times bigger than the input file size.

Video processing tutorial file exchange matlab central. The first frame is the original image with all 220 colors. Each successive frame has half the number of colors. Learn more about frames, avi, convert image processing toolbox. Create a videoreader object for the example movie file xylophone. To extract the contents of a zip file programmatically, use the unzip function. I managed to use the code posted by arvind kumar and extracted automatically about 6000 frames from a. Extracting frames from webcam follow 52 views last 30 days khaled alfaleh on 26 mar 2017. From the looks of it, matlab has a problem reading that file probably because the file is badly encoded or the video was encoded with a codec that is not supported.

Convert video to individual frames in matlab duration. Read one or more video frames matlab read mathworks italia. Please also tell me what would i need to do if i need to extract frames after a particular time delay. Hello, is there any code or inbuilt function for extracting motion vectors frame to frame from mpeg4 h. Matlab signal analysis frame by frame analysis of a signal silence removal audio example. Is anyone familiar with extracting image from avi video. Read yuv videos and extract the frames file exchange. You can specify several namevalue pair arguments in any order as name1,value1. Read on, heres a mini howto extract an image from video clips.

First i will be showing you how to extract data from line plots, then i will be. Im trying to extract all frames of some videos each of them contains around 00 frames with this code but it take gets too long to extract all of the frames. When we extract just one frame, we can opt out f image2 from the command above. Hi everyone, i want to extract the frame from my running webcam every 3 second i want to extract the frame and save it into variable to process it later so. Follow 35 views last 30 days gopalakrishnan venkatesan on 9 jul 2015. I also need to extract pictures from video files, but it seems to me that format is. A comparative analysis of the efficiency of video reader object for. Frame data, specified as a 1by1 structure array representing a single frame, or a 1byf array of structures representing multiple frames. Extract image from pdf file matlab answers matlab central. Matlab object tracking using webcam tutorial matlab detect red. How can i extract frames of a video in matlab if i have used mmreader to read the video. Nabeel ahmed on 16 mar 2018 i want to extract frames from a video and save them in a file. The frame array is typically returned by the getframe function if colormap is not empty, then each element of cdata should be a 2d heightbywidth array. Make video snapshots, extract video frames to jpg files.

Convert the frames to image files using videoreader and the imwrite function. Read one or more video frames matlab read mathworks. I am using the following code to read and extract entire frames of a video, but problem is. In this video, i will be showing you how to extract or read data from saved matlab figure file. Yuvread returns the y, u and v components of a video in separate matrices. Microcontroller kits user manual, motor control boards, msp430 tutorials, news. Issue is that i have seen on sites that read method got used but it is not available in matlab 2015. Write video data to file matlab writevideo mathworks. How to design basic gui graphical user interface in matlab and image processing duration. When the videoformat property of v is indexed or grayscale, the data type and dimensions of video depend on whether you call read with the native argument. Read one frame at a time until currenttime reaches 0. The last frame has the minimum number of colors, 2. The program itself will save frames from a video file to a sequence of jpg images. Hello, i need to import an image of a page from a pdf file, ive been able to do this using ghostscritp, but the problem is that it has to read the pdf and write the image to a file, and then a different routine has to read the image from the file, and this process takes more time that the actual processing i do with the image afterwards.

How to extract frames from a video in matlab learn more about computer vision system toolbox, image processing, emotion detection, face tracking, face recognition image acquisition toolbox, image processing toolbox, computer vision toolbox. I need to parse through the pdf and extract the particular text in the. Use the im2frame function to convert the images into frames of a movie. In this tutorial, we will use the online file converter at that is absolutely free to use and allows us to convert files without the need of installing any software. Just you need to create the folder name aliiiii in matlab directory. All the conversion is done on some fast servers in the net.

Video frame data, returned as a numeric or structure array. The most common of these formats are wmv, mp4, m4v, avi and. So, i need to extract the iframes and then encrypt them. Matlab creates a folder with the same name as the zip file, and extracts the entire contents of the zip file into this folder. Learn more about video frames, frame extraction, frame reading. Im working on project to encryption video mp4 by using i want to extract only i frame from video stream, can you told me how to determine iframe and how to extract it. This code demonstrates to convert avi file formats to sequence of frames. Examples functions release notes pdf documentation. Create object to read video files matlab mathworks.

160 1055 426 601 502 511 1311 1294 1025 891 1178 34 1018 585 848 267 1181 633 132 843 174 301 379 47 1346 1434 1446 1014 829